The Yeah Yeah Yeahs have announced two shows at San Francisco’s Davies Symphony Hall on July 14 and 15, and we’ve got presale codes for tickets, which go on sale this week.

The Yeah Yeah Yeahs, led by Karen O and best known for the song “Maps,” has promised a different sort of tour — one which visits a range of venues, from the highbrow Royal Albert Hall on down to the modest San Diego County Fair.

“We will be digging deep into our back catalogue,” the band wrote in a tour announcement. “We’ll be playing songs that are rarely (if ever) performed, alongside all time favorites with new arrangements to delight…and yes, there will be acoustic guitars and strings too.”
